Key facts about Masterclass Certificate in Robotics for Live Shows
Our Masterclass Certificate in Robotics for Live Shows is designed to equip participants with the necessary skills and knowledge to create captivating live performances using robotics technology. By the end of the course, students will be able to design and program robotic systems for live entertainment, integrate robotics seamlessly into live shows, and troubleshoot technical issues that may arise during performances.
The duration of the Masterclass Certificate in Robotics for Live Shows is 6 weeks, with a total of 12 sessions. Each session is carefully crafted to cover essential topics such as robotics programming, motion control, sensor integration, and safety protocols for live shows. Participants will also have the opportunity to work on hands-on projects to apply their learning in real-world scenarios.
This Masterclass Certificate in Robotics for Live Shows is highly relevant to professionals in the entertainment industry, including event planners, stage managers, production designers, and technical directors. The skills acquired in this course are in high demand for live shows, concerts, theater productions, theme parks, and other entertainment events where robotics technology is used to enhance the audience experience.
